𝓣𝓱𝓮 𝓢𝓸𝓬𝓲𝓮𝓽𝔂

Once singular figures of their own cause who stood atop societies social strata, the Society - formed by Arthur Mark, though not lead by - are an anonymous High-Council whom works in the dark in order to serve the light. Genius’ and Warriors alike, the Society lives within each and every crevice both the light had and had not touched. Where they’re everywhere and nowhere, the Senecan Society lives to form a brighter future - no matter the cost.

Due to the collective genius and cunning of the various members of the Society, the group resides within the South lake of Silijan, Sweden - directly seventy feet underneath its waters. There, the Senecan Society pulls the strings of the world.

𝓘𝓷𝓽𝓮𝓻𝓲𝓸𝓻 & 𝓕𝓪𝓬𝓲𝓵𝓲𝓽𝓲𝓮𝓼

  • Society Fallout Shelter(𝒮.𝐹.𝒮.)

No Caption Provided

The SFS Or Society Fallout Shelter is an enormous complex built hundreds of feet underground to shelter, protect, and offer means of a secondary base in case of an emergency to the main level. Funded and built by Thomas Richard's fortune and the expertise of Thomas' best friend King Bett's this fortress comes with all of the basic needs and upgrades of a regular fallout bunker but offers much much more in the way of space and community functionality. Within the main complex resides a Gym and training area, Reconnaissance area, and vehicle storage, along with weapons storage and a fully stocked kitchen.

The SFS provides enough floor area, with to accommodate 20 to 30 people and their needed supplies comfortably, for a year or more, of autonomous shelterization without needing to step a foot outside. The compressive bunker includes a massive front bulkhead wall, with a solid adamantium and Vibranium blast door entrance. The SFS is submerged and protected under thick soil and solid, designed to withstand a 500,000-pound internal blast while being strategically separated from any other important facilities by about 400 to 500 feet. The Bunker is protected by the same security system of Thomas' Clocktower, which consists of traps like lasers, trap doors, electrified fences, flashing lights, sliding staircases, sentries and more. All meant to incapacitate, or in a worse situation even kill. The security system and AI of the Bunker run through several systems within Mark Towers and Richard Towers making it virtually one of the highest Level security systems on the planet.

  • The Laboratory

    No Caption Provided

A laboratory whose futuristic properties meet its modern, the Senecan Societies cutting-edge substructure proves as one of the more prominent amendments to the Societies headquarters. Not only is it home to Damon Ford’s works, but the teams more hazardous devices as well e.g. SXR materials (Soft X-Ray) station, REIXS (Resonant Elastic and Inelastic Soft X-Ray Scattering) end-station, Semiconductor Tracker, etc. The lab itself is equipped with an unparalleled and highly-advanced A.I. system which solely functions as the laboratory’s automated security interface. Firstly, each and every tile of the laboratory’s surface - floor - is retrofitted with a pressurized plate system, (P.P.S.). The main purpose of the labs P.P.S. Is to prevent any unauthorized persons and anything of the like. Each member of the Society is logged within the labs P.P.S by their own distinct weight and walk patterns unless one was to erase that information.

Additionally, the Societies laboratory is equipped with numerous access and exit routines. The main being the titanium-shielded, four-layered, clear blast doors. Though each access point within the lab is equipped with both a finger and retinal scan system.

  • Technological Facility

No Caption Provided

When discussing how The Society would operate from behind the scenes in a modern setting, Helena Troy and Arthur Mark realized that it was imperative to have resources at their disposal that were fitting for the golden age of technology. As such, Arthur Mark took upon himself to design and construct a technological facility that would allow the group to stay well ahead of the technological curve on a global scale. The location would be a garage sort that would serve the purpose of analyzing, constructing and containing various equipment and devices under the ownership of The Society, both created and obtained by the group. The area itself is fitted with mechanical numerous extremities that will actively move and construct larger crafts and mechanisms such as equipment, weapons, and vehicles.

Numerous drones, nanorobots, anti-graviton, platforms, and androids are provided for assistance in transporting, containing and managing the more small scale creations within the facility. It contains a technical lab that holds any and all needed equipment needed to analyze and create the various devices that would be employed by the group. From basic monitors, to electromagnetic near-field scanners. The area is also conjoined with a warehouse for broken or discarded parts. Each area within the location is powered by Arthur's own ionic fission technology in order to keep the entire environment operational with a clean, reusable energy source. Lastly, the entire department is overseen and managed by an artificial intelligence referred to as "STEVE" (Smart Technology Encompassing Virtually Everything). This department is accessible to all members of the Society to work on and obtain equipment at any given time. It does, however, require a full body and DNA analysis before entry is given.

𝓜𝓲𝓼𝓬𝓮𝓵𝓵𝓪𝓷𝓮𝓸𝓾𝓼 𝓡𝓸𝓸𝓶𝓼

  • Society Council Room

No Caption Provided

Acting as, seemingly the first room that one sees when they walk into the Societies stronghold, the Council is no more than what is listed as, a council. Though due to the collective imagination of Helana Troy and Arthur Mark, the Council - within - is a technological marvel. Firstly, on the outside, the board is a typical round oak-wood surface with no more than a dozen leathered seats, though this is farthest from the truth. Embedded within the floor of which holds the room itself, sits a chain of mechanical appliances that both the board and seats to retract from within the base of the room. This is due to the same system the lab utilizes, P.P.S. Each and every micro-ounce is measured by the Council Room’s P.P.S. So whenever one of the plates changes their recorded weight, both the board and seats retract from the base of the room opposed to keeping its original position due to the non-flux in the recorded weight records of the P.P.S. Due to this, at first glance, the Council is seemingly non-existence, that is until said weight change.

To add onto the Councils many marvels, the oak-wood table of which they insinuate on is, too, embedded with a holographic system, one of which activates and deactivates due to one simple press of a button - a button of which is located at the very base of the table (the basic reach being eight feet.) The holographic system stretches six feet outwards, enlarging itself to the same scale from whichever point of view one is standing or sitting at.

  • Hall of Fallen Heroes - Memorial Service Area

No Caption Provided

When Arthur Mark and Helena Troy envisioned the Memorial Room, they looked to the future and past for inspiration. Instead of burying the fallen outside of the base, they dedicated an entire room to those who had fallen in battle. Combining their intelligence and expertise, the two based their design off of the Bronze Age of Greece with touches of the future. The architects formed a circular platform with a holographic image of the deceased warrior emitting from it. The body of the platform itself was decorated with the figure of the person, depicting the most essential events in the deceased warrior's life. Installed into the projector was a voice virtual assistant that would aid anyone curious about the person's life, retelling their origins and death through the painted scenery on the platform. Surrounding the memorial of the person were personal items such as jewelry, equipment, and much more.

𝓘𝓷𝓽𝓮𝓻𝓷𝓪𝓵 & 𝓔𝔁𝓽𝓮𝓻𝓷𝓪𝓵 𝓛𝓪𝔂𝓸𝓾𝓽 - 𝓢𝓮𝓬𝓾𝓻𝓲𝓽𝔂 𝓜𝓮𝓪𝓼𝓾𝓻𝓮𝓼

  • Layout

No Caption Provided

As the rest of the building is, the Society's headquarters exterior - external layout - is fitted with a multi-layered construct; one of which is sustainable to large-scale abrasion and damage e.g. large explosions, salt-water deterioration, and so on. Unlike the internal designs, the exterior outer-walls and one-way windows are compacted with these multi-layered materials, materials of which range from stainless steel to titanium dipped irons. Underneath the base, six total, titanium prongs keep the base at bay, each of them drilled twenty-six feet into Silijan’s surface, keeping a steady motion. These prongs count by ten feet in width, and seventeen in length. Though the base itself is outfitted with the standard silver and grey scheme, also being able to keep a parallelogram - hypercube - stature.

No Caption Provided

Inside the base’s grim exterior holds a color scheme similar to one of Greek Mythology - courtesy of Helena Troy, Shield Maiden. White marble surface coupled with a vibrant white granite plastered across the walls, the Society's Homebase manages to keep its modern vibe to it while paying homage to those of Greece. Each room requires a three-step security process, a retinal, palm, and finally, a body scan. All of this information is stored within a fleet of super-computers, all stored within the technological facility.

If needed, the headquarters of the Society also conveniences members with four, distinct - though similar - master bedrooms & bathrooms; though those are rarely sought after.

  • Defense Mechanism #1 & 2 - Universal Thether & Dichotomy Paradox

No Caption Provided

The HQ is located underwater in a lake. Its a cubical design with no doors or windows but tethered by anchors that extend to different points across the universe. Each tethered anchor is connected to a different compartment to the HQ. Upon command, any compartment can be jettisoned to whatever point of the universe they are anchored.

No Caption Provided

Based on the calculation of Zeno of Elea, and multiple universal tethers, the HQ can shunt space into a spatial field which makes reaching an unauthorized destination to be on an infinite scale. To reach any destination, one must cover half the intended distance and half of that distance until the total distance is covered. Being able to shunt small amounts of space from different points of the universe stacks space into an amount of time cannot compensate.

  • Defense Mechanism #3 - Nano Freeze

No Caption Provided

Scattered across the internal atmosphere of the HQ are microscopic nanobots. These nanorobots absorb the thermal energy in their environment, and use said energy to replicate themselves using the ambient matter in the atmosphere. This creates a chain of increasingly smaller, faster and more efficient nanorobots that will remove virtually and heat from their proximity. The result is the effect of absolute-zero, making it virtually possible for an intruder to move, let alone leave their frozen environment.
